Lessons and skill updates were being written with stiff, highly-specific content (exact function names, file paths, memory references) that narrows applicability and breaks self-containment. This tightens both skills to enforce abstraction.
usethis-lesson-create(v1.0 → v1.1)New "Self-containment and abstraction" section with three rules: never reference memories, never name specific code objects unless they are the subject, and state principles at the right abstraction level
Comparison table showing "too specific" vs generalised rewrites:
